ARIZONA JURISPRUDENCE FINAL PAPER 2025/2026
Q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S GUARANTEE A+
✔✔US Educated Application Requirements - ✔✔-Be of good moral character

-complete the application process

-grad from accredited PT program

-passed NPTE

-passed law exam

-get fingerprint card

✔✔Foreign-educated PT requirements - ✔✔-be of good moral character

-complete application process

-provide evidence that education is equivalent

-provide evidence they can practice w/o limits in country from education

-proof of legal auth to live/work in US

-passed english proficiency exams

-participated in interim supervised clinical practice

-passed NPTE

-passed law exam

-get fingerprint card

✔✔How can foreign PT bypass supervised clin-ed and extra coursework? - ✔✔If person
is deemed graduate of accredited program by the board

✔✔PTA Certification Requirements - ✔✔-be of good moral character

-complete application

-graduate from accredited program

-passed national exam

,-passed law exam

-get fingerprint card

✔✔"Substantially equivalent" foreign education - ✔✔-prepares them to engage in PT
practice w/o restriction

-school is recognized by own ministry of education

-undergo a credential evaluation

-complete any additional education

✔✔Why would a license get denied? - ✔✔-knowing making a false statement

-committing fraud on application

-committing a felony (w/or w/o moral turpitude) or misdemeanor w/moral turpitude

-attempting to undermine integrity of the exam

-engage in disciplinary violation

✔✔If you fail NPTE on first attempt, do you have to reapply? - ✔✔No you can retake
w/in 6 mos after first failure

✔✔Interim permit - foreign educated - ✔✔if they satisfy requirements and allows them
to participate in supervised clinical practice period

*not allowable if they fail NPTE

✔✔Interim permit - US educated - ✔✔if they complete the applications but board
determines they lack competence to practice

✔✔How long is interim permit good for? - ✔✔90 days - 6 months

✔✔What does the interim permit holder have to complete? - ✔✔period of clinical
practice supervised by constant and on-site clinical PT

✔✔what happens to license if you do not submit renewal application and pay fee on
time? - ✔✔license is suspended

✔✔letters to designate retired status - ✔✔"(ret.)" after "PT"

, ✔✔T/F: for each pt on day of service, PT must provide/doc all intervention that requires
a PT and determine care from PTA or aide is safe - ✔✔true

✔✔when is it legally required to refer a pt? - ✔✔if PT has reasonable cause to believe
sx or conditions are present that require services beyond scope or PT is contraindicated

✔✔When can an applicant take the exam? - ✔✔when they have met all of the
requirements

-paid the fees

If not yet graduated:
-above plus
--submitted a letter saying they will graduate, the exam is <120 days from the grad date,
they meet all of the program requirements

✔✔Licensure by endorsement - ✔✔PT or PTA w/valid unrestricted license in another
US jurisdiction

✔✔License renewal - suspension - ✔✔-if not renewed by expiration date

-if fees arent paid

✔✔When is license reinstated? - ✔✔If suspended and renewal and reinstatement fees
are paid

✔✔When does a suspended license have to reapply? What else do they have to do? -
✔✔-if suspended > 3 consecutive years

-Must demo:
--practicing for a specific time under interim permit
--completing remedial courses
--complete con-ed requirements for period of lapsed license
--pass a law or NPTE exam

✔✔requirements if license is suspended < 3 years after renewal date - ✔✔can apply for
reinstatement by submitting application, paying reinstatement and renewal fee

✔✔Original license fee - ✔✔300

✔✔renewal license fee - ✔✔300

✔✔license reinstatement application fee - ✔✔300
